What is concentration?
The concentration of a chemical substance expresses the amount of a substance present in a mixture.
What is the urine concentration?
The concentration of the urine is determined from the ratio of mass to volume of the urine or density of the urine.
Urine Concentration = mass / volume
Urine concentration = 4 .007 g / 4 ml
Urine concentration = 1.002 g/ml
Thus, the concentration of the urine is 1.002 g/ml
